BusinessService

Description
Business Service

Type : Complex Element

Definition
Provides information about a specific service supporting a business process. A business process is made up of one or more business services. Each business service then maps one-to-one to a specific message (e.g. ACORD Life and Annuity 1201), so for our purposes a message and service may be thought of synonymously (a service can be thought of as an implementation of a message). Each service may support either/both inputs (messages it consumes) or outputs (messages it produces).The business service can be used to identify the specific specification used (e.g. "ACORD Life and Annuity Transaction Specifications" for "ACORD LA Document Send Transaction Specification").
